Preventing Septic Tank Odor: The Role of Proper Pipe Sizing

A well-functioning septic system is essential for any home without access to a public sewer system. However, one common problem that homeowners encounter is the unpleasant odor emanating from their septic tank. While various factors can contribute to septic tank odor, one often-overlooked aspect is proper pipe sizing. This article delves into the crucial relationship between pipe sizing and septic tank odor control.

Understanding the Link Between Pipe Sizing and Septic Odor

Septic tanks are designed to separate solid waste from wastewater. The solids settle to the bottom of the tank, while the liquid portion flows out through an outlet pipe into the drain field. Proper pipe sizing plays a vital role in this process. If the pipes are too small, they can restrict the flow of wastewater, creating a buildup of pressure and potentially causing a number of problems, including:

  • Reduced Flow Rates: Smaller pipes create more resistance to wastewater flow, slowing down the process of liquids reaching the drain field. This can lead to a backlog of wastewater in the tank, potentially leading to overflowing and backups.
  • Increased Pressure: As the flow of wastewater is restricted, pressure builds up in the septic system. This pressure can force wastewater back up through the pipes, resulting in a foul odor in the house or yard.
  • Slow Solid Decomposition: When wastewater doesn't flow efficiently, it can stagnate in the tank. This can lead to slowed decomposition of solids, further contributing to the build-up of pressure and odor.

Factors Influencing Pipe Sizing

Determining the appropriate pipe size for your septic system involves considering several crucial factors:

1. Home Size and Occupancy

The number of bathrooms, bedrooms, and occupants in your home directly impacts the amount of wastewater generated. A larger family will produce more waste, requiring larger pipes to handle the increased flow.

2. Fixture Usage

The type and frequency of fixture usage also influence pipe sizing. For instance, a home with multiple showers and bathtubs might necessitate larger pipes than a home with only a few fixtures.

3. Pipe Material

The material used for your septic pipes affects flow rate and potential for odor. PVC pipes, commonly used for septic systems, offer smoother surfaces, reducing friction and promoting efficient flow. However, older pipes made of cast iron or clay can become clogged over time, hindering flow and increasing the likelihood of odors.

4. Distance to Drain Field

The distance between the septic tank and the drain field is crucial for proper pipe sizing. Longer distances necessitate larger pipes to compensate for the increased friction and potential for pressure loss.

5. Elevation Difference

The elevation difference between the septic tank and the drain field impacts gravity flow. If there is a significant elevation difference, larger pipes might be needed to ensure adequate wastewater flow.

Best Practices for Pipe Sizing in Septic Systems

To avoid septic tank odor problems, follow these best practices for pipe sizing:

1. Consult a Professional

The best way to ensure proper pipe sizing is to consult a qualified septic system installer or engineer. They can assess your specific needs and provide detailed recommendations based on your home's size, fixture usage, and other factors.

2. Use the Right Material

PVC pipes are generally recommended for septic systems due to their smooth surface and resistance to corrosion. Avoid using cast iron or clay pipes, as they can become problematic over time.

3. Consider the Future

When sizing your pipes, think about potential future needs. If you plan to add bathrooms or other fixtures in the future, it's best to install pipes that can accommodate those additions.

4. Regular Maintenance

Even with proper pipe sizing, regular maintenance is crucial for preventing septic tank odor. This includes:

  • Regular Pumping: Schedule routine septic tank pumping every 3-5 years to prevent sludge buildup.
  • Inspection and Cleaning: Have your septic system inspected periodically to identify any potential issues with pipes or other components.
  • Proper Waste Disposal: Avoid putting items like grease, oils, and chemicals down the drain, as they can harm your septic system.
